An Inconvenient Truth

An Inconvenient TruthToday I went to see Al Gore’s movie, An Inconvenient Truth. I didn’t really know what to expect, but I had heard a lot of positive buzz about the film and the IMDB rating is 8.2, which is off the chart.

The movie is a documentary and is more like sitting through a PowerPoint presentation than actually watching a movie. In fact, the vast majority of the movie is watching Mr. Gore actually giving a presentation to an audience somewhere. Although that might sound a bit boring, the movie grabbed and held my attention from beginning to end.

Love Seafood? Then Help Protect It.

Seafood WatchI love to eat seafood. But since there are a few billion other people that share that sentiment, many varieties of fish are being taken at an alarming rate. In fact, at a rate that cannot be sustained.

So, the Aquarium in Monterey California has put together this nifty site which is designed to help educate us all regarding which seafood comes from sustainable sources, and which is killing off the species.

500 Miles Per Gallon… Coming Soon!

Hymotion Electric VehicleThere is a company called Hymotion which has developed an add on for Hybrid Electric vehicles such as the Toyota Prius, Ford Escape Hybrid and Mercury Mariner Hybrid which allows these vehicles to plug into an outlet over night and drive 50 miles further on an electric charge.
